Epididymo-Orchitis

Protocols

Clinical Features:

·       A swollen, discolored or warm scrotum.

·       Testicle pain and tenderness, usually on one side, that often comes on slowly.

·       Pain when you pass urine.

·       An urgent or frequent need to urinate.

·       Discharge from the penis.

·       Pain or discomfort in the lower abdomen or pelvic area.

·       Blood in the semen.

·       Less commonly, fever.



 Investigation:

  • CBC 
  • USG of Scrotum

উপদেশঃ

  • Rest in bed
  • Lie down so that your scrotum is elevated
  • Apply cold packs to your scrotum as tolerated
  • Avoid lifting heavy objects
